What i want is by default yesoptions radiobuttonlist and nooptions radiobuttonlist shoulsd be dis. Here mudassar ahmed khan has explained with an example, how to enable and disable a textbox when radiobutton is clicked i. Add attribute ariapressed and class active manually to activate a radio and checkbox button. Radios to slider is a jquery plugin to transform radio buttons into a nice styled value slider that allows you to pick a option with a simple sliding effect. How do i make a button inactive on radio button click. Nooptions radiobuttonlist should get enabled and yesoptions radiobutton list shouls be disabled. Load the latest jquery library, simplebuttonradios. We have a form we were using with the old signature custom coded signature field and are now using the new signature field in forms 9. If the input is checked, this will also get the uicheckboxradiochecked class. Highly customizable checkboxes and radio buttons jquery and zepto.
Radio button disableenable script javascript and ajax. Jul 10, 2019 here mudassar ahmed khan has explained with an example, how to enable and disable a textbox when radiobutton is clicked i. It is intentionally not styled, to preserve crossbrowser compatibility and the user experience. When checkbox is licked, i want the radio button is enable, and if check box is unchecked, i want the enabledisable radio button with check box jquery forum. How to make disabledreadonly functionality for radio. Add the inputs id as the value of the for attribute of the label add radio buttons to a group by adding the name attribute along with the same corresponding value for each of the radio buttons in the group. Powerful jquery checkbox and radio button enhancing plugin. How to create custom radio buttons using css and jquery. This property reflects the html disabled attribute.
If buttonset specific styling is needed, the following css class names. This could be a bit tricky to solve because it looks like readonly for radio buttons is just disabled, and from i can tell, forms doesnt seem to ever store new valuesinputs for disabled fields. The radio class is a simple wrapper around the html elements. To color the submit button or apply other effects, you have to select the element using the jquery. At present they can select an option, then choose one of the others which then disables it, leaving it still checked although disabled, some people may not knownotice the difference.
The above function will check your radiobutton1 element using the clientid property to resolve the appropriate id that will be rendered clientside. So originally, there will be no radio buttons within the abc div. If the input is of type radio, this will also get the ui checkboxradio radio label class. This element will additionally have the uibuttonicononly class, depending on the showlabel and icon options uibuttonicon. Jul 04, 2016 this will now prevent any action when the user clicks on the button and will also grey out the button to make it visible to the user that it is disabled. For the sake of simplicity, we have used separate images to specify the different states of a radio button like normal, hover, selected etc. You have an unordered list within each list item you have a radio input.
The action is specified as a string in the first argument e. Now we have a working custom radio button but lets make it look even better by adding some animation. Customizable radio button plugin with jquery simple. Ive faked readonly on a radio button by disabling only the unchecked radio buttons. Disabling radio buttons with jquery stack overflow. Jun 09, 2018 to make this radio button function properly we have set an id for each radio button and assigned that to the corresponding label in for attribute. I ran a quick test and even if i disabled the field after populating the value, forms still ignored the input when it moved onto the next form in the process this could be a bit tricky to solve because it looks like readonly for radio buttons is just disabled, and from i can tell, forms doesnt seem to ever. In this example, we will disable the over 65 radio button. When the radiobutton is clicked based on whether the yes radiobutton is checked selected or unchecked deselected, the textbox will be enabled or disabled. How to make stylish checkboxes and radio buttons with css3. How to disable a specific radio button, on a page, and. I have a list of grouped radio buttons how to make it required that atleast one needs to be checked off in each group each name.
How to check or uncheck radio button dynamically using jquery. The radio class is a simple wrapper around the radio html elements. Radio buttons can also be used for grouped button sets where only a single button can be selected at once, such as a view switcher control. Customizable checkbox plugin with jquery and bootstrap simplebtchecks. Getting started using jquery using jquery plugins using jquery ui developing jquery core developing jquery plugins developing jquery ui qunit and testing about the jquery forum jquery conferences jquery mobile developing jquery mobile. This will only be present if an icon is provided in the icon option uibuttoniconspace.
Hi gloria, i think the problem is that you are setting the fields to disabled. Jquery checkbox and checklist demo and styling with or without description text. I wrote this code its woking fine with enabling the radio. You can find more video clips, slides and relevant training material for learning the jquery library at.
A jquery checkboxes and radio buttons plugin with keyboard accessibility navigation. The for attribute is necessary to bind our custom radio button with the input. In this demo, a simple page is created with radio buttons. If you need to create custom checkboxes, the method is the same. It keeps the user from selecting a different value, and the checked value will always post on submit. Ultimately what i want to do is create an array of options, loop through them and output a list of options as radio buttons. See the examplecode online by clicking the link or image below. Hi i need help with enabling disabling radiobuttonlist from client side my form looks like this.
A protip by bjacog about button, jqueryui, buttonset, jquery, radio, deselect, deselection, and jquery 1. Enable disable radiobuttonlist with another radiobbuttonlist selection asp. So, i added a class newclass to the 1st radio button, and changed the above line of code to be. Tutorials one of the best jquery websites that provide web designers and developers with a. And, get the value and text of the selected radio button using jquery. When using an input of type button, submit or reset, support is limited to plain text labels with no icons. How to make signature field not required if a radio button is. The only way i can think of right now to get around this would be to add another. To make a horizontal radio button set, add the datatypehorizontal to the fieldset. You can use the jquery prop method to check or uncheck radio button dynamically such as on click of button or an hyperlink etc. If buttonset specific styling is needed, the following css class names can be used for overrides or as keys for the classes option. If certain radio button groups were disabled by default and only enabled once the user has chosen one of the first radio buttons that would be much better. Now, i need to add another radio button to this page, and allow the user to select the 2nd radio button, and still keep the 1st radio button disabled. How to disable a specific radio button, on a page, and allow.
The buttonset widget uses the jquery ui css framework to style its look and feel. When clicked save button on bottom, validation should happen. To make this radio button function properly we have set an id for each radio button and assigned that to the corresponding label in for attribute. When we check to see if there is any text added to the searchinput element and we find some, we then can set the disabled attribute to false therefore enabling the button, with the following code. What if i need to create a new radio button without any preexisting ones. Make sure the linked radio buttons have the same value for their name html attribute.
The disabled property sets or returns whether a radio button should be disabled, or not. If the icon option is enabled, the generated icon has this class. How to make signature field not required if a radio button. Radio buttons are used when the user must make only one selection out of a group of items. You can stop the submission of the form by making the submit button disabled. Customizable radio button plugin with jquery simplebutton. A group of three radio buttons is used that uses the radio class by bootstrap.
Here you can see a button with only icon, a button with two icons and a disabled button. We had the following jquery that would allow us to submit the form if a specific radio button option was selected. If the icon option is enabled, an extra element with this class as added between the text label and the icon. Disabled elements are usually rendered in gray by default in browsers. Will be hidden, with its associated label positioned on top.
You can use the prop function to set the checked property to true for a particular element as follows. A keyup event handlers on the search input can also be used to provide the same onthe. Powerful jquery checkbox and radio button enhancing plugin rlchecked. You can check a radio button by default by adding the checked html attribute to. What to do is add an event handler to the radio buttons such that when they are clicked fnfilter is called with the search parameter that you want, and on the column you want. If there are more than two radio buttons on your form, youll have to modify the selector, for example, you can use the starts with attribute filter to pick out the radios whose id starts with ticketid. Button enhances standard form elements like buttons, inputs and anchors to themeable buttons with appropriate hover and active styles. Checkboxes and radio buttons customization jquery and zepto. Enable disable radiobuttonlist with another radiobbuttonlist. How to disable a jquery button initially and after user.
I would recommend you to use change event instead of click. And it works fine, but only if i have existing radio button options. A radio button is a component used to allow a user to make a single choice among a number of options whereas checkboxes are used for selecting multiple options. Enable disable textbox on radiobutton click checked. If the input is of type radio, this will also get the uicheckboxradioradiolabel class uicheckboxradioicon. Here, in this example, we have created simple html form with some radio buttons and by using jquery on change event, we will show, how enable and disable function works. This is a short video clip that explains how we can create jquery radio buttons. A separator element between icon and text content of the button. Make sure the path is set to the location where you have jquery saved. In this example the input field mytext will be enabled when the checkbox mycheck. Radio buttons can be used in different scenarios with where in some cases they must be disabled. You need to set the disabled property of button which can achieved via using. We can disable a radio button by using disabled attribute which will disable and prevent selection of the radio button.
The button action, params method can perform an action on buttons, such as disabling the button. A friend asked me for some help on doing the following. If you have a couple of radio s in a button set or not and want to be able to unselect any selected item you can implement the below fix which uses a custom param in the html and jquery. Working with radio buttons and jquery radio buttons are one of the essential html elements that you can find in almost any website that contains a form for users to enter data. A keyup event handlers on the search input can also be used to provide the same onthefly searching that datatables provides by default.
This will now prevent any action when the user clicks on the button and will also grey out the button to make it visible to the user that it is disabled. Radio button plugin allows you to customize the appearance of radio button elements. Now when we click on the radio button, the switch is moving smoothly instead of jumping quickly. There can be more than one disabled button element. Mobile radio buttons as real buttons, simple look and feel with a. In order to make the switch smooth, we assign the transition of 0. Load the latest jquery library, simple button radios.
1330 1050 144 1174 983 845 1059 137 306 1265 478 711 617 1309 1242 1490 1486 132 1191 1526 1066 468 298 402 22 477 1123 55 618 753 1627 303 1209 340 590 842 371 557 593 1358 191 85 1048 1375 1074